**Rafa Benitez’s Future at Panathinaikos in Jeopardy: Is Unemployment Looming?**
Former Liverpool and Real Madrid manager Rafa Benitez’s coaching career is once again hanging in the balance as reports from Greece indicate that Panathinaikos are considering parting ways with him. Benitez, a seasoned 65-year-old Spaniard, made a high-profile entrance to Athens in October amid much excitement. However, his time at the helm has quickly taken a turn for the worse, leaving his future at the club uncertain.
**Struggles at Panathinaikos**
Benitez’s tenure at Panathinaikos has been far from smooth sailing despite the initial optimism surrounding his arrival. The highly respected coach, who boasts an impressive resume that includes stints at top clubs such as Liverpool and Real Madrid, has struggled to make an impact in Greece. Despite signing a lucrative two-and-a-half-year contract with a reported salary of around £3.5 million, Benitez has failed to deliver the expected revolution at the club.
